이벤트 버블링 : 자식노드에서 부모노드 순으로 이벤트를 실행하는것
html
<html lang="en">
<style> * { border: 1px solid Black; } </style>
<head> <meta charset="utf-8"> <script src="index.js"></script> </head>
<body> <h1 id="header"> <p id="pagagraph">Pagagraph</p> </h1> </body> </html> |
javascript
window.onload=function() {
document.getElementById('header').onclick=function() { alert('header'); };
document.getElementById('pagagraph').onclick=function(e) {
var event = e || window.event; alert('pagagraph');
event.cancelBubble=true;
if(event.stopPropagation) { event.stopPropagation(); } };
|
'Developer > Javascript' 카테고리의 다른 글
HTML Body에서 클릭 이벤트 처리 (0) | 2013.12.14 |
---|---|
Array객체 정렬 (오름차순, 내림차순) (0) | 2013.12.10 |
string을 자바스크립트 코드로 실행 - eval() (0) | 2013.12.07 |
가변인자 함수 (0) | 2013.12.07 |